Maintenance Supervisor

Magris TalcTimmins, ON

About The Position

Directly supports and oversees the site wide Mill Maintenance Program. Fully supports, implements, and enforces the Magris Talc HR, HSEQ programs as outlined in the Company polices, CBA, Provincial and Federal regulations, and laws. Oversees administrative duties of Timmins Operations Administrator that are related to hourly Maintenance employees.

Requirements

  • Mechanical and / or Electrical skilled Tradespeople with progressive experience.
  • Mechanical and / or Electrical Engineering Technician or Technologist preferred.
  • MMP Certification is an asset.
  • Experience in maintenance of Mill Process equipment.
  • Computer and programming skills. MP2, AX, Excel viewed as an asset.
  • Attention to detail, data entry accuracy and efficiency.
  • Ability to be self-directed and can work in an organized manner in a fast-paced environment.
  • Good overall interpersonal skills and leadership style.
  • Leads self, effectively leads others, and encourages good collaboration and cooperation within team, across departments and with external resources.
  • Effective Project management.
  • Ability to apply mathematical concepts and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to effectively write and present reports.
